About the Role
Join our dynamic team as the Vice President of Financial Strategy and Analysis! In this pivotal leadership role, you will drive strategic financial planning and ensure our financial goals align seamlessly with our business strategies. You will oversee our comprehensive financial planning process, ranging from annual budgeting to long-term strategic initiatives, whilst providing essential financial analysis and reporting to facilitate executive decision-making.
As the VP of Financial Strategy and Analysis, your responsibilities will include:
• Leading forecasting, budgeting, and managing financial operations.
• Ensuring compliance with relevant accounting principles and regulations.
• Coaching and mentoring a high-performance finance team.
• Analyzing international financial data and guiding capital expenditure evaluations.
• Being a strategic partner to the business, advising on financial implications of key decisions.
We are looking for candidates with:
• A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field.
• At least 10 years of experience in finance, with a minimum of 5 years in a senior FP&A leadership role.
• A strong background in financial modeling, forecasting, and budgeting.
• A deep understanding of business and financial acumen, supported by advanced analytical skills.
• Exceptional strategic thinking, problem-solving capabilities, and excellent communication skills.
